Boutique Hotel Matlai ★★★★
"What an amazing place. Even before we arrived there I had been impressed. I wrote several emails to the owner, Inge, and received replies almost by return. All her replies were helpful and answered my queries. We were blown away with this wonderful place. They had built the hotel from scratch and it is obvious that they have thought of everything. Each detail is worked out. Even having a place to charge our phones which is always convenient. The rooms are perfect and all different. We had the 2 rooms in Kidoshi which were rather Arabic and 2 rooms in Asili House which were more African. Beautiful toiletries where you could choose the scent for your bath and also for your room. Very comfortable beds and every amenity. There is a cabinet outside the room to get cold drinks at all times. There is too much to mention but it was all perfect. Management team Inge and Tim clearly care a great deal about the hotel and maintaining extremely high standards. They were always very friendly and helpful to us - both throughout our stay and over email in response to questions Perhaps best of all - the service from the butlers. The butler team was simply amazing, such lovely people, all with professional yet personable service. The attention to detail and effort put into service each day and night was amazing. The staff are helpful and friendly. Nothing is too much trouble. You can also play football, darts, boule, ladder golf and volleyball with the staff. The rooms are immaculate and cleaned regularly. Breakfast is from a vast choice and can be eaten anywhere. The all-day menu contains anything you might want. There is a new dinner menu with many choices every night. All delicious. We were an extended family of 9 people of varying ages and there was always something for all of us. Sometimes so much it was difficult to choose. The facilities are plentiful - spacious grounds, lots of sunbeds, hammocks, daybeds etc. for a small amount of people (only 4 rooms). The grounds are so well-kept and beautifully designed. It is hard to describe how perfectly balanced this place is The location is on the beach. The tides go in and out quite a long way. It is interesting to walk on the sand (in reef shoes provided by the hotel) and see all the sea urchins, brittle stars and water snakes stranded in pools. We went on a Dhow boat and snorkelled with lots of fish, clams and anemones etc. We then went on the boat to an area full of star fish. There are other interesting trips we did to Stone Town, on quad bikes to a village, a spice tour and visit to the National Park to see Red Colobus monkeys. We didn’t want to leave and all want to return. I had hoped that my family would have a holiday of a lifetime………..they did!! Thank you so much "

Upendo Beach Boutique Hotel Zanzibar ★★★★
"My husband and I visited on the last leg of our honeymoon, following 6 nights on safari in Kenya. We were sadly not overly impressed by our stay here. We were greeted by the manager, who was very friendly and receptive, and did his best throughout our stay to ensure we were happy. We had no complaints about the hotel itself, rooms were lovely, the hotel was clean, and a lovely white beach / ocean view. However, this hotel / location is just missing something. We were on a half board catering basis, and although the food was really delicious at Upendo, it was the same small menu & cuisine every day, and we very quickly got bored of the food / had everything that we fancied over the 6 days we stayed. The restaurant has a very relaxed vibe / not a very romantic setting - it's more of a day time beach bar, which is fine for lunch, but we expected somewhere more formal for evening meals. We felt this was generally the same in all eating places along the beach, and we really struggled to find somewhere to eat each day, particularly Valentines day. There were a few issues during our stay including building work going on right outside our room (at the place next door), palm trees bashing against our room throughout the night, sewage smell coming into our bathroom, and the hygiene of the staff who came to turn down our room each day. This is not a reflection of the hotel itself, but sadly meant that our experience on holiday here was not what we had in mind. The hotel manager did do his best to rectify some of the issues and we were grateful of that. Another thing to note, is we were not aware before about the crime / culture / safety on the island - upon arrival we were advised not to walk right along the beach, but even walking left, we were harassed by children looking for money / staring at our pockets and felt very uncomfortable. We did not feel at ease to leave the hotel despite the multiple day trips on offer, which was a shame. Overall, the food offerings and variety let this down for us, and lack of formal restaurant / no atmosphere."
